Chorizo (/ tʃəˈriːzoʊ, - soʊ /, from Spanish [tʃoˈɾiθo]) or chouriço (from Portuguese [ʃo (w)ˈɾisu]) is a type of pork sausage. In Europe, chorizo is a fermented, cured, smoked sausage, which may be sliced and eaten without cooking, or added as an ingredient to add flavor to other dishes. The ingredients needed to make Chorizo & Potato Tacos:
  1. Prepare 45 oz chorizo
  2. Take 2 medium-large Idaho potatoes; peeled
  3. Prepare 6 jalapeños; small dice
  4. Make ready 4 clove garlic; minced
  5. Make ready 1 large yellow onion; small dice
  6. Prepare 1 green bell pepper; medium dice
  7. Make ready 1 red bell pepper; medium dice
  8. Make ready 1 stalk celery; small dice
  9. Prepare 1 bundle cilantro; chiffonade
  10. Make ready 16 oz roasted tomato salsa
  11. Get 2 tsp smoked paprika
  12. Get 2 tsp dried oregano
  13. Prepare 1 tsp cayenne pepper
  14. Prepare 1 pinch salt and black pepper; to taste
  15. Make ready 1 vegetable oil; as needed

Mexican chorizo is made with fresh (raw, uncooked) pork, while the Spanish version is usually. Chorizo sausages originated in Spain and Portugal, and versions of them exist throughout Latin America. Unlike most varieties of Spanish or Iberian chorizo (which is cured and dried in a way somewhat similar to salami or pepperoni), Mexican chorizo is a raw, ground sausage that must be cooked before eating. Mexican chorizo is typically made with ground pork but you can also use ground beef or turkey.

Instructions to make Chorizo & Potato Tacos:
  1. Cut potatoes into small, bite size pieces. Cover with cold water. Add salt. Boil until 90% cooked. Drain. Briefly submerge into ice bath to halt carry over cooking. Drain. Set aside
  2. Heat a large saute pan over medium-high heat. Add chorizo. Season.
  3. Once fat had rendered from chorizo, add veggies.
  4. When veggies are nearly tender, add garlic and potatoes. Add vegetable oil if needed. When garlic is cooked, approximately 1 minute, add salsa. Reduce until salsa is incorporated. Stir in cilantro.
  5. Variations; Corn, zucchini, sofrito, vinegar, avocado, poblano, habanero, bacon, coriander, epazote, cilantro, mole, nopalitos
